An educational support organization in the United Kingdom is looking for a dedicated Primary School SATs Tutor to assist Year 6 pupils in preparing for SATs examinations. This full-time, temporary role involves delivering targeted tutoring in English and Maths, identifying learning gaps, and supporting pupils with exam techniques and confidence building.

The ideal candidate should have:

  • a graduate degree
  • experience with Key Stage 2 pupils
  • strong knowledge of SATs content

Immediate start available.

How to prepare for a job interview at Empowering Learning

Know Your SATs Inside Out

Make sure you’re well-versed in the SATs content for Year 6, especially in English and Maths. Brush up on the curriculum and be ready to discuss specific topics or techniques you would use to help pupils overcome their learning gaps.

Showcase Your Tutoring Experience

Prepare to share examples from your past tutoring experiences, particularly with Key Stage 2 pupils. Highlight any successful strategies you've implemented that helped students build confidence and improve their exam techniques.

Engage with the Interviewers

During the interview, don’t just answer questions—engage with the interviewers. Ask them about their approach to tutoring and how they support their tutors. This shows your genuine interest in the role and helps you gauge if it’s the right fit for you.

Demonstrate Your Passion for Education

Let your enthusiasm for teaching shine through! Share why you love working with children and how you can make a difference in their SATs preparation. A positive attitude can really set you apart from other candidates.
